Abstract

Judgement on the situation of women in employment and family. concepts and desires on equal rights. Topics: judgement on politicians as parliamentary representatives; attitude to personal political involvement and political consciousness (scale); personal opinion leadership; fair share of life; judgement on personal economic situation; importance of areas of life; compatibility of employment and family; general attitude to leave for new parent for fathers and attitude to taking advantage of such a leave for new parent in one´s own family; father or mother as primarily responsible for child care and raising children; judgement on development of children in full-time kindergarten or otherwise outside of the family; satisfaction with kindergarten situation; importance of economic independence of women; attitude to marriage as institution; perceived discrimination against women at work; attitude to this discrimination; attitude to women in male occupations, women as superiors and as colleagues; importance of occupational success for men or women; assessment of equal pay and judgement on career chances of men and women; adequate realization of equal rights; realization of equal rights as individual or government task; knowledge of or attitude to the equal status authorities or women´s offices; attitude to more women in leading positions in politics and business; attitude to a quota of women; attitude to making it easier to re-enter the job market and occupational support measures for women; preference for part-time work; most able party in questions of equal rights; party preference; interest in politics; women in one´s circle of friends who are beaten by their husbands (violence in marriage); necessity of personal intervention in such a case; most important factors for restricted leisure opportunities; personal athletic activity and attendance at athletic or cultural events; main focus when watching television; frequency of reading and main focus of interests in...
